我正在使用SourceSafe 2005,我在VB.NET Framework 4中有一个项目。
我想要的是一种自动化构建过程的方法,并希望集成简单的部署。我希望能够在构建时发送自动通知,列出消息正文中SourceSafe签到的注释。
我看了几个选项,其中一些令人困惑。我已经看到它用SVN,nAnt和CruiseControl实现了,但看起来可能需要很长时间才能成为上述技术的新手。
在您看来,最简单的方法是设置这样的东西?
如果我必须开始使用SVN,那么这也是可能的。
答案 0 :(得分:1)
如果您正在寻找简单的构建并可能部署到第一个环境,您应该能够使用任意数量的工具,包括CC.Net等免费工具和Sylvanaar提到的团队级CI解决方案。
如果部署变得棘手,我公司的工具(urbancode.com)可能更合适,因为我们非常关注CI的“构建后的内容”部分。
顺便说一下,VSS是存储源代码的一个非常糟糕的地方(我听说它被多个客户端称为“视觉源碎纸机”)。微软的新TFS更好,Subversion(以及许多其他人)也是如此。您无需切换源代码控制即可实现构建和部署。许多CI工具都有VSS集成(你可以找到一个列表here),但朋友不要让朋友使用VSS。
答案 1 :(得分:0)
我建议TeamCity它支持SourceSafe和构建SLN或通过MSBUILD。